Plank fuselage with 1.5 mm balsa… … underside with 2 mm balsa. The fuselage top is planked with 1.5 mm at the front. The fuselage back is planked with 1.5 mm balsa and at the top it is rounded with 4 mm balsa leftovers. 4 mm balsa sanded.

The undercarriage cover is made of 3 layers of balsa. The first Pants made of 4 x 6 mm balsa (image without 2 mm side pieces). layer is cut out of 1.5 mm balsa with overlap. For filling in width, 3 mm balsa is used.
